International Steel Market Daily: Italy Became Turkey's Largest Hot Coil Export Destination in May

Affected by the impact of low-priced resources in Asia and trade protection measures, the demand in some major export markets has been sluggish. Turkey exported 294,000 tons of flat products in May, a year-on-year decrease of 25.86%; the export volume of hot coils was 129,000 tons, a year-on-year decrease of 30%. Italy was once again Turkey's largest HRC export destination, with imports of 31,600t, up 1.5% year-on-year. Egypt ranked second, importing 22,800 tons, nearly double the year-on-year increase; Denmark imported 14,000 tons, an increase of 7% year-on-year; Algeria and Iraq imported 8,200 tons and 8,100 tons respectively.

In terms of domestic trade, Turkish buyers returned from the Eid al-Adha holiday this week and returned to the market, but transactions remained sluggish. Mysteel estimates that the ex-factory price of Turkish hot coil will remain at US$680/ton on July 7.
